The Canon Stereo Microphone DM-E1D is a compact, plug-in powered shotgun mic designed for EOS cameras with a multi-function shoe. It offers versatile directional modes (Shotgun and Stereo) controlled via the cameraโs touchscreen, eliminating cables and batteries for seamless, high-quality audio capture in interviews, concerts, and nature scenes.

Stereo or shotgun modes
I've never been a big fan of stereo mics, but this one is very good. I use it on the 90 degree setting. It picks up dialogue just like in shotgun mode, with the added ambiance of stereo. Recommended.

The Audio Quality Is Not Great
I tried this microphone. The AD converters are noisy. Like unusable. The mic only goes up to 10KHz. Most shotgun mics go to 20KHz. Having a dedicated button to access the audio menu was convenient but that and not having to use an 1/8th in cable are literally the only good things about this mic. I cannot stress how poorly this product sounds. I love Canon, but they really need to stick to lenses and camera bodies. I returned mine. Shure, Sennheiser and Rode all offer noticeably superior products for the same price or less.
